When developing the new Extreme2 shock, our main focus was on consistent friction reduction. Thanks to the resulting efficiency and precision, we are now even better able to master the balancing act between road and extreme off-road use. Just as it should be for real adventure motorcycles. Furthermore, the reduced friction also has an extremely positive effect on wear, so that your shock absorber retains its performance after years of extreme use.
The extreme reduction in friction has been achieved, among other things, by the special “low friction” piston bands, which significantly improve the sliding behaviour of the new 46 mm pistons. This significantly refines the response behaviour of the Extreme2 dampers.
Especially for the Extreme2 Plug & Travel suspension we have developed a newly designed electronic spring preload in a space-saving design. This now enables uncomplicated installation without the need to attach the EPA pump externally.
A lot of suspension has the problem of the damper oil heating up excessively when the suspension strut is subjected to constant hard use. The resulting change in viscosity drastically reduces damper performance. If temperatures rise, wear also increases exponentially, which can lead to irreparable failure of the entire component.
To avoid this, the Extreme2 damper has a new reservoir design with more oil volume and better heat dissipation. This means that we can categorically rule out even the smallest drops in performance.
The new damper is rounded off with an extended compression adjustment range at low and high speed. This allows the damping to be adjusted even more precisely to all requirements.
In addition, the Extreme2 shock absorber has all the features of the Extreme1 shock absorber.

What is DDA?
On BMWs DDA stands for Dynamic Damping Adjustment (or Dynamic Damping Assistance). This is a feature of Touratech’s Extreme2 shock absorbers , that allows the suspension’s damping to adjust automatically and in real-time to the riding situation.
Key features of DDA:
- Automatic Adjustment: The system uses a high-performance DDA valve (patented by Tractive) to change the damping characteristics in fractions of a second based on the riding surface and conditions.
- Integration: Aftermarket DDA systems are designed to integrate with the motorcycle’s original control units, allowing the rider to retain the use of the stock handlebar switches and riding modes (e.g., “Rain”, “Road”, “Dynamic”).
- Enhanced Performance: It is designed to provide better stability and handling, particularly for long-distance touring, by ensuring consistent and optimal damping regardless of the load or terrain.
BMW’s factory-installed version of this technology is typically called Dynamic ESA (Electronic Suspension Adjustment) or DDC (Dynamic Damping Control). The DDA systems are premium aftermarket alternatives that offer enhanced performance and durability, especially for heavy use or off-road conditions.
